Sec. 2(22)(e) not applicable to inter banking transactions between group concerns

March 13, 2019 1317 Views 0 comment Print

Since the transaction between assessee-company and other group concern were in the nature of current account and inter banking account containing both types of entries i.e., receipts and payments and assessee was neither the beneficial nor the registered shareholder of the company, therefore, the amount received from other group concern could not be brought in the purview of loans and advances so as to attract Section 2(22)(e).

Applicability of amended Section 43B on employees contribution to PF

March 12, 2019 5484 Views 0 comment Print

Since both the employee’s and employer’s contribution to Provident Fund was covered under the amended provision of section 43B, therefore Employees contribution to Provident fund (EPF), beyond the due date stipulated under the Provident Fund Act but before the due date of filing return of income under section 139(1) could not be disallowed by invoking section 43B of Income Tax Act, 1961.
